Hotel Information
The hotel Metropol is located directly by the Lloret, a sandy beach. It is in a fantastic location near many restaurants and bars and is a perfect place to sit back and relax in Costa Brava. Attractions in the area include Lloret Beach, 350 yards away, or Santa Clotilde Gardens, situated 1.2 miles from the property.
Hotel Metropol provides a seasonal outdoor swimming pool, as well as free WiFi and a fitness centre. Boasting a 24-hour front desk, this property also provides guests with a restaurant. A continental breakfast and a delicious dinner can be enjoyed at the property.
Modern, well-lilt rooms with an optional sea view. Equipped with a bathroom, Wi-Fi, LED TV, fridge, hair dryer, magnifying mirror and safe.

That's the trouble with booking flights via a third party website.
Booking.com is great for booking accommodation, but these "pseudo" package deals where they put together a hotel and flight that you could easily book separately are not worth the hassle.
Any issue with the flights, and you have to chase for refunds through booking.com rather than deal direct with the airline.
Unless it's a true package deal (e.g. TUI etc..), I would always book flights direct with the airline, and hotel separately.

You do realise how the hotel star system works don’t you?
It’s based on services available rather than how luxurious the hotel is.
A lot of people don’t realise this.
